Remote Area Medical (RAM) will be hosting a free medical event at the Lake Charles Civic Center on November 13 and 14, 2020.

All services are free and the event is open to the public.

Dental, medical, and vision services are provided on a first-come, first-serve basis. Due to time constraints, be prepared to choose between dental and vision services, as there might not be enough time for one patient to receive both. Medical services are offered to every patient attending the clinic.

Patients will be able to get free glasses made on-site for anyone who has a valid prescription dated within the last year.

The patient parking lot for the Remote Area Medical (RAM) event at the Lake Charles Civic Center will open no later than 12:01 am (midnight) on Friday, November 13, 2020. As patients arrive at the parking lot, they will be provided with additional information regarding clinic opening processes and the next steps. Clinic doors open at 6 am.

All patients will be required to wear a face-covering and must undergo a COVID-19 screening before entering the clinic.

This process will repeat on Saturday, November 14, 2020

In some situations, such as inclement weather, volunteer cancellations, or other circumstances outside of RAM’s control, the parking lot opening patient check-in may occur earlier. RAM encourages everyone who would like services, especially dental services, to arrive as early as possible.

The above details are subject to change.
